On 16 August 2016, the National Bank of Ukraine, upon the proposal of the Deposit Guarantee Fund, issued Decision No. 215-рш on Withdrawal of the Banking License and Liquidation of EUROBANK PJSC.
Eurobank PJSC was declared insolvent on 17 June 2016 after it was revealed that the bank performed deposit splitting transactions, i.e. transferring funds from current accounts of legal entities to accounts of individuals in the amount below UAH 200 thousand.
Pursuant to paragraph 5 of first part of Article 76 of the Law of Ukraine On Banks and Banking, NBU has to adopt a decision on declaring a bank insolvent if it is revealed that the bank has performed transactions, as a result of which liabilities before individuals within the guaranteed redemption amount increase owing to reduced liabilities before the legal entities.
